Pulsed Amperometric Detector for High-Performance Liquid Chromatography
FeaturesWide application fields
The measuring method is classified into three modes (pulsed amperometry and potential scan) by the
difference of potential patterns and signal transfer. The flow cell of the ED703 Pulse can be adapted
to the various analyses only by exchange of the optional working electrode, diamond and gold.
Easy maintenance
The assembly and disassembly of the flow cell are carried out by finger-tightening without a special tool.
A excellent reproducibility of carbohydrate analysis is performed by combination of the gold electrode
with the pulsed amperometric mode.
Standard equipment of cell oven
The cell oven is fitted up with the ED703 Pulse as a standard equipment. Extremely high stable
analysis is obtained because of a constant temperature of flow cell. Also, the connection of a
separation column and a flow cell becomes the shortest, because this oven can establish a column
up to 25 cm long.
